General Terms of Use
1- Purpose
These general terms and conditions of sale apply to the acceptance of customers’ vehicles following a booking on royalnavette.ch, which provides a vehicle storage service for vehicles entrusted to it by its customers. To this end, it enters into a contract with its customers, the elements of which are these general terms and conditions, together with any amendments.
2- Liability of royalnavette.ch
The liability of royalnavette.ch begins upon receipt of the vehicle. Consequently, one copy of the confirmation is kept by each party. The service includes the storage of the vehicle in our private and secure car park, as well as the free shuttle transfer. royalnavette.ch is not liable for breakdowns or damage occurring to vehicles entrusted to it, nor for their consequences, particularly those resulting from lack of maintenance, electronic, mechanical or tyre defects, wear and tear of parts and components necessary for the proper operation of the vehicle, or insufficient oil, fuel or water. In the event that royalnavette.ch is liable, it shall only be liable for material damage within the limit of the insurance cover taken out with Helvetia, up to CHF 5,000,000. royalnavette.ch accepts no liability in the event of storms, hail or any other damage caused by natural causes. royalnavette.ch reserves the right to start vehicles using jump leads in the event of a flat battery and may move vehicles if necessary. royalnavette.ch offers various additional services: cancellation insurance and vehicle cleaning, the details and prices of which are shown on our “prices” page. If the customer chooses any of these services, they acknowledge that they owe royalnavette.ch the price of these services.
3- Customer liability
The booking must be made on our website royalnavette.ch at least 24 hours before the desired time. After this period, bookings can only be made by telephone. The customer pays for the services provided by royalnavette.ch by credit card at the time of booking. The customer contractually undertakes to hand over the keys to their vehicle when it is handed over to the staff of royalnavette.ch. The customer must leave the vehicle registration document and emissions certificate in the glove compartment of their vehicle and entrust their vehicle to us with both number plates. No refund will be made in the event of cancellation less than 24 hours before the collection of your vehicle, except in the event of flight cancellation. Refunds for bookings are made in the form of credit in the loyalty account, which can be viewed in the customer area. At the customer’s request and by email, the refund may be made to the credit card used by the customer who made the booking. Please keep your booking confirmation in a safe place and be ready to present it when the vehicle is returned. In the event of loss of the confirmation, royalnavette.ch cannot be held liable if it is presented by a third party who uses it fraudulently to collect the vehicle. royalnavette.ch undertakes to cover all damage caused to the bodywork of the customer’s vehicle, provided that a descriptive vehicle condition report was carried out upon collection and at the customer’s request, that the damage or new condition was noted by both parties, and that a mutually agreed descriptive report is drawn up upon return, before the customer leaves the collection point. If no descriptive report was carried out when the vehicle was collected, royalnavette.ch accepts no liability for any potential damage and shall not be liable for disputes concerning the condition of the vehicle raised after its return.
4- Applicable law and disputes
This contract is governed by Swiss law. Any dispute relating to its interpretation and performance shall fall under the exclusive jurisdiction of the courts of Geneva. royalnavette.ch reserves the right to modify part or all of these general terms of use at any time.
